Hallo chess friends,

some days ago Vincent posted a position that looked difficult for chess
programs. The FEN was:
Original pos: 7k/2q3pP/6P1/8/8/8/6Pp/2RR3K/ w - -.

After some moves I came to the related position
Modified pos: 4q2k/6pP/6P1/3R/8/8/6Pp/5R1K/ w - -
This modified position I gave to a modified crafty and it found a win.
